Output d89aa3119d782782c3899f6ac085a8ffde7cce11856cb24eaee5e4533257859c:0

value
3584900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0660f50b3cd6fc384b8f60d38afd455783d0a110 OP_EQUAL
address
32Gk8Q7SjbX8ksktuxj88P4AxmgADZzuMF
transaction
d89aa3119d782782c3899f6ac085a8ffde7cce11856cb24eaee5e4533257859c
spent
true